Boman, Sonu To Share Relationship Secrets On Farah's Show

Apart from testing their culinary skills in the forthcoming episode of cookery show “Farah Ki Daawat”, actors Boman Irani and Sonu Sood will be seen sharing their respective love stories with TV viewers.
 
And co-incidentally, food will play a major role in their stories.
 
While sharing his emotional and personal aspects with food, Boman will reveal that he started his career as a waiter and used to run a bakery where he sold chips for 12 years before starting out in Bollywood.
 
He will be seen talking about how he met his wife Zenobia when she used to visit his bakery every day and bought chips in order to get his attention. Also, Zenobia will mention that her father had become suspicious about this habit of hers. So, in order to distract her father, she used to buy the chips and then give it to a beggar or a child in need, but continued buying chips from Boman’s bakery.
 
Meanwhile, Sonu will also share some of his secrets, including that he was dating his wife Sonali while he was an engineering student in Kanpur.
 
The “Dabangg” fame actor will reveal that during their courtship period, Sonali and Sonu used to love eating 'dahi samosa'.
 
The episode featuring the “Happy New Year” co-stars will be aired on Sunday on Colors.
